ANNIE EZELLE
Annie D. Ezelle, 74, of 2395 Rocklick Hollow Road, New Paris, died at 10 a.m. Tuesday, April 15, 2003, at home.
Born in Orangeburg, Orangeburg County, South Carolina on Thursday, November 1, 1928, she was the daughter of the late E.D. and Pearl (Nettles) O'Quinn.
She was the widow of Oliver L. Ezelle, whom she married July 19, 1952 and he preceeded her in death September 18, 1965.
She is survived by daughter: Patricia L. wife of Daniel Emmell, New Paris; son: James D. husband of Sandra Courtier Ezelle, The Dalles, Ore.; son: John D. Ezelle, Portland, Ore.; sister: Nel Parson, The Dalles, Ore. She is also survived by six grandchildren and three great-grandchildren.
Mrs. Ezelle was affiliated with The Christian & Missionary Alliance Church of Bedford.
Funeral services at Mickle-Geisel Funeral Home at 11 a.m. on Friday, with Rev. Jeff Lonsinger officiating. Interment at Cuppett Cemetery, New Paris.
Friends are invited to call Friday 9:30 until 11 a.m. at Mickle-Geisel Funeral Home, Schellsburg. (Obituary written by family and published April 17th, 2003 in the Bedford Gazette, pg. 16)
